The electric vehicle (EV) ducts market is poised for significant growth between 2025 and 2030, driven by the accelerating adoption of electric mobility and the increasing focus on thermal management solutions in EVs. EV ducts, which are essential components for channeling airflow to batteries, power electronics, and motors, play a critical role in maintaining optimal operating temperatures and enhancing overall vehicle efficiency. As manufacturers aim to improve range, performance, and safety, the demand for advanced duct systems is expected to rise globally.

Key Features

EV ducts are designed to efficiently guide air or coolant through battery packs and electronic components, ensuring temperature regulation under varying operational conditions. High-performance materials, lightweight construction, and precise aerodynamic design are key features that enhance thermal management while contributing to vehicle weight reduction. Modular and customizable designs allow seamless integration across different EV models, improving manufacturing flexibility.

Applications

EV ducts are primarily used in battery packs, power electronics, electric motors, and HVAC systems within electric vehicles. They help manage heat in lithium-ion batteries, prevent overheating of inverters and motors, and optimize cabin climate control. Their application spans passenger electric cars, commercial EVs, and electric buses, making them essential for both consumer and fleet electric mobility solutions.

Trends

The market is witnessing a shift toward lightweight, high-strength, and thermally conductive materials for duct manufacturing. Integration of computational fluid dynamics (CFD) in duct design is becoming standard to optimize airflow efficiency. Collaboration between EV manufacturers and component suppliers to develop modular, scalable duct systems is another emerging trend, enabling faster vehicle development cycles.
